Transaction 6c40616c0e03546ee081a43ac1c1799c0585fed3700fb70d652ebe24b7cca06a

14 Input
1 Outputs
  • 6c40616c0e03546ee081a43ac1c1799c0585fed3700fb70d652ebe24b7cca06a:0
  • value  3188982
    address  1NNTHtjhLNjYPmz8ZqgCmaN6JvaeDbrTgs